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3971 269 648915 66983705649
0422622 73629977865 558
0422622 73629977865 558
25488653456 678 19 1840
All about undefined
Interested in learning more?
0422622 73629977865 558
25488653456 678 19 1840
See more
566771601 52708764528 41768885515
77688453009 17787981 127
See more
7616165859 408 215
66631567 65575 031418201 3753931
See more